type Device interface {
// Select returns true if addr is addressed to this device, false otherwise.
// Th device should get any values it needs from the registers (such as AC).
Select(addr uint16, mk *MK12) bool
// Get is called to receive 12-bits of input from the device when the ORAC
// control signal is asserted.
Get() (data uint16)
// The IOT instruction is broken down into three stages, the device should
// implement the proper functionality at each stage by returning 3 booleans
// that represent control signals:
// skp - IOSKIP - Skip the next instruction if this is true at any stage
// clr - ACCLR - Clear the AC register if this is true at any stage
// or - ORAC - OR input data with AC and store it in AC
Iop1() (skip bool, clr bool, or bool)
Iop2() (skip bool, clr bool, or bool)
Iop4() (skip bool, clr bool, or bool)
}
const (
PT_READER = 0o01
PT_PUNCH = 0o02
TT_KEYBOARD = 0o03
TT_PRINTER = 0o04
)
